Stone cladding installation services involve applying natural or manufactured stone materials to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building. This process typically includes preparing the surface, selecting appropriate stone types, and securely attaching the stones to ensure a durable and aesthetically pleasing finish. Skilled installers may also incorporate additional elements such as insulation or weatherproofing to enhance the property's overall performance and appearance. The goal is to create a visually appealing façade or feature wall that adds texture and character while providing long-lasting protection.
One of the primary benefits of stone cladding installation is its ability to address issues related to building durability and insulation. Stone cladding can shield structures from weather elements like rain, wind, and temperature fluctuations, helping to prevent moisture intrusion and thermal loss. Additionally, it can serve as a protective barrier that minimizes wear and tear on the underlying structure. For property owners, this means reducing the need for frequent repairs or maintenance while enhancing the building’s overall resilience and visual appeal.

Material Costs - The cost of stone materials for cladding typically ranges from $10 to $30 per square foot, depending on the type of stone chosen, such as limestone or sandstone. Higher-end options like marble or granite can increase material expenses. Local pros can provide specific quotes based on project scope.
Labor Expenses - Installation labor costs generally fall between $20 and $50 per square foot, influenced by the complexity of the design and site conditions. More intricate patterns or difficult access may raise labor charges.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ates.
Additional Fees - Additional costs may include surface preparation, scaffolding, or sealing, which can add $2 to $10 per square foot. These extras vary based on project requirements and site specifics. Local contractors can clarify potential additional expenses.
Overall Project Cost - The total cost for stone cladding installation often ranges from $30 to $80 per square foot, combining materials, labor, and extras. Larger projects may benefit from bulk pricing or discounts. Reach out to local pros to obtain precise cost assessments for specific projects.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
